If you look in any popular science book on this topic, it will tell you that the sky is blue because of rayleigh scattering in the atmosphere.

The Blue Component Of The Spectrum Of Visible Light Has Shorter Wavelengths And Higher Frequencies Than The Red Component.


The blue color of the sky is due to rayleigh scattering. When we look towards the sun at sunset, we see red and orange colours because the blue light has been scattered out and away from the line of sight.
